Immigrants from Zimbabwe vs Immigrants from Afghanistan Single Female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 117,320,666 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Zimbabwe and poverty level among single females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.481 and weighted average of 20.0%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 146,836,819 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Afghanistan and poverty level among single females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.325 and weighted average of 20.0%, a difference of 0.18%.
